The Enchanted Silk of the Sky: A Caterpillar's Dream

In the heart of a lush, verdant forest, where the leaves whispered secrets of ancient times and the sun danced through the canopy, lived a small, curious caterpillar named Zephyr. Zephyr was unlike any other caterpillar; he had a dream that was as vast and boundless as the sky itself. His dream was to find the Enchanted Silk of the Sky, a magical fiber that, according to the stories his grandmother had told him, could weave dreams into reality.

One bright morning, as the first rays of the sun pierced through the dense foliage, Zephyr set out on his quest. He carried with him a small, tattered map that had been passed down through generations of his family, each line and symbol imbued with the wisdom of countless ancestors. The map led him to a place called the Whispering Vines, where the trees spoke in hushed tones and the air shimmered with a faint, ethereal glow.

As Zephyr traveled, he encountered a myriad of creatures, each with their own tales and warnings about the dangers that lay ahead. A wise old owl named Orin, with eyes that glowed like twin moons, advised him, "The path you seek is fraught with peril, Zephyr. But remember, courage is not the absence of fear, but the triumph over it."

Zephyr nodded, his resolve strengthened by the owl's words. He continued his journey, crossing a river that sang with the melodies of the forest spirits and climbing a mountain whose peaks kissed the clouds. Along the way, he befriended a mischievous squirrel named Nutkin, who, with his acrobatic skills and quick wit, became his steadfast companion.

As they neared the Whispering Vines, the path grew more treacherous. Zephyr and Nutkin had to navigate a maze of thorny vines and avoid the watchful eyes of the forest guardian, a majestic stag with antlers that shone like stars. With each step, Zephyr felt the weight of his dream pressing down on him, but he pressed on, driven by the promise of the Enchanted Silk.

Finally, they reached the Whispering Vines. The trees were tall and grand, their branches intertwining to form a canopy that seemed to block out the sky. Zephyr felt a strange sensation, as if the very air around him was charged with magic. Nutkin, ever the practical one, whispered, "Be careful, Zephyr. These vines are no ordinary trees."

Zephyr took a deep breath and approached the first vine. To his astonishment, the vine began to glow, its leaves shimmering with a soft, otherworldly light. As he touched the vine, a warm, tingling sensation spread through his body. He felt a surge of energy, as if the very essence of the forest was flowing into him.

The Enchanted Silk was not a single thread but a tapestry woven from countless fibers, each one glowing with its own unique light. Zephyr knew that to claim the silk, he must weave his own dreams into the tapestry. He closed his eyes and visualized his dream, a world where all creatures lived in harmony and the sky was a canvas of endless colors.

With a determined whisper, he began to weave, his fingers moving with the grace of a seasoned artist. The silk responded to his touch, wrapping itself around his fingers and intertwining with his dreams. The tapestry grew, its colors becoming more vivid, its patterns more intricate.

As the final thread was woven, the silk pulsed with a blinding light. Zephyr opened his eyes to find himself standing in a field of dreams, where the sky was a tapestry of stars and the ground was a sea of dreams. He had done it; he had found the Enchanted Silk of the Sky.

Nutkin, his eyes wide with wonder, said, "Zephyr, you've done it. You've brought our dreams to life!"

Zephyr smiled, his heart swelling with pride and joy. He had not only found the Enchanted Silk but had also discovered the true power of dreams. With the silk in his possession, he knew that he could share his world with others, showing them the beauty of their own dreams.

And so, Zephyr returned to his home, carrying the Enchanted Silk of the Sky with him. He shared his journey with the creatures of the forest, and together, they built a world where dreams were woven into reality, and the sky was a canvas of endless possibilities.

In the end, Zephyr's quest was not just about finding the Enchanted Silk; it was about discovering the power of dreams and the courage to pursue them. And as the stars twinkled above, Zephyr knew that his dream had come true, and that the sky was indeed the limit.
